What Is a Freight Forwarding Company?

A freight forwarding company acts as a professional partner between businesses and transportation providers. Freight forwarders arrange the movement of goods from one location to another and coordinate different stages of the shipping process.

Depending on the shipment requirements, a freight forwarder may arrange sea freight services, air freight services, road transportation, warehousing, customs clearance, and other logistics solutions.

Instead of dealing with multiple shipping providers on your own, you can work with one experienced freight forwarding company that manages the different parts of your shipment.

3. Compare Sea, Air and Road Freight Options

Different shipments require different transportation methods. Sea freight services are often suitable for large or heavy shipments where cost efficiency is important. Full Container Load (FCL) and Less than Container Load (LCL) options can be used depending on cargo volume.

On the other hand, air freight services are generally preferred when speed is a major priority. Businesses shipping urgent, valuable, or time-sensitive products may benefit from air transportation.

Road freight can also play an important role in connecting warehouses, ports, airports, and final destinations. A reliable global freight forwarder should help you select the transportation method that best fits your shipment.

7. Compare Pricing and Overall Value

Price is important, but choosing the cheapest provider is not always the best decision. A low initial price may not include certain charges, documentation costs, customs-related expenses, handling fees, or other services.

Instead of comparing only the quoted price, compare the overall value offered by different freight forwarding services.

Ask for a clear quotation and understand what is included. A reliable logistics company should provide transparent information about the costs associated with your shipment.
